Understanding German Shepherd Prices

When it comes to the cost of German Shepherds, there are several elements to consider. On average, authentic German Shepherds from Germany can range from $1,500 to $3,000 or more. Here’s a breakdown of the factors that influence these prices:

  • Pedigree: The lineage of the dog plays a significant role in its price. Dogs from champion bloodlines or those with a strong pedigree are generally more expensive.
  • Breeder Reputation: Established breeders who have a reputation for producing high-quality dogs often charge higher prices. Investing in a reputable breeder can also ensure that you’re getting a healthy puppy with a good temperament.
  • Dog’s Purpose: German Shepherds bred for specific jobs, such as police work, protection, or competition, may have higher price tags due to their specialized training and characteristics.
  • Location: Prices can vary based on geographical location. Urban areas may see higher prices due to demand, while rural areas might offer more affordable options.

Puppy Costs and Initial Investments

Purchasing a German Shepherd puppy isn’t the only expense you’ll encounter. Here are some initial costs to consider:

  • Vaccinations and Health Checks: Puppies require a series of vaccinations and health checks, which can add several hundred dollars to your initial investment.
  • Microchipping: This essential procedure can cost around $50 to $100, helping ensure your dog can be identified if lost.
  • Basic Training: Investing in obedience training is crucial for a well-behaved German Shepherd. Group classes may cost between $150 and $300.
  • Supplies: Don’t forget to factor in costs for food, grooming, toys, and other essentials, which can total several hundred dollars in the first year.

Life Costs of Dog Ownership

Owning a German Shepherd is a rewarding experience, but it’s essential to be aware of the ongoing costs associated with dog ownership:

  • Food: A high-quality dog food for a large breed like a German Shepherd can cost $50 to $100 a month.
  • Regular Vet Visits: Routine check-ups, vaccinations, and emergency care can add up to $300 to $600 annually.
  • Grooming: Depending on the dog’s coat, grooming costs can range from $30 to $100 per session.
  • Insurance: Pet insurance can help cover unexpected medical costs, typically ranging from $25 to $70 per month.

Choosing the Right Breeder

Finding the right breeder is crucial in ensuring you get a healthy and well-adjusted German Shepherd. Here are some tips:

  • Visit the Breeder: Always visit the breeder’s facility to assess the living conditions and meet the puppies’ parents.
  • Ask for Health Clearances: Request health clearances for both parents to ensure you’re aware of any potential genetic issues.
  • Observe the Puppies: Spend time observing the puppies’ behavior. A well-bred dog should display curiosity and confidence.
